How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Melody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Melody Hill Studio Apartments | $1,624 | $1,150 | $1,902 |
| Melody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,973 | $1,275 | $3,012 |
| Melody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,520 | $1,275 | $5,000 |
| Melody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,990 | $1,899 | $4,145 |
| Melody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,326 | $2,209 | $2,443 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Melody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$2,318 | $1,700 | $2,895 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$3,203 | $2,695 | $4,500 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$3,524 | $3,000 | $4,000 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$3,999 | $3,999 | $3,999 |
